/*--------公用样式-----------*/
body {
	margin:0;
	padding:0;
	font-family: "宋体";
	font-size:12px;
	color:#333333;
	text-align:center;
	line-height:100%;
	left: 2px;
	top: 1px;
	right: 2px;
	bottom: 1px;
	float: left;
	background-color: #CCCCCC;
	border: 0px solid #FF9900;
}
form { margin:0;padding:0;}
img { border:0}
h1, h2, h3 {font-size:14px;font-weight: normal;color: #333333;text-align:center;line-height:160%;}
p, blockquote, ol, ul {line-height: 160%;}
a {color: #333333;}
a:link,a:visited {text-decoration: none;}
a:hover {text-decoration: underline;}
select {height:19px;font-size:12px}
input {font-size:12px;line-height:120%;}
li{ list-style-type:none}
ul{margin:0;padding:0}

/*--------公用特殊样式-----------*/
.more{ float:right;color:#FC3D07;width:80px;font-size:12px;font-weight:normal;text-align:right;margin-right:8px;}
.tit_a{background:url(../images/bg_tit_2.gif) no-repeat right;width:60px; display:block;float:left}
.textli_1{}
.texttime{float:right;color:#CCCCCC;width:80px;}
.input_text1{width:110px;height:20px;}
.img_1{margin-right:6px}
.awithe{color:#FFF;}
/*--------=======================--------------主页样式--------------=======================-----------*/
.tittop{background:url(../images/bg_tit_1.gif);height:30px; width:986px;padding-top:0px;margin:0px auto;}
.tittop a{color:#FFFFFF;}
.tittop .tit_l{float:left;width:300px;line-height:200%;}
.tittop .tit_r{
	float:right;
	width:300px;
	color:#FFF;
	height: 30px;
}
.banner{background:url(../images/banner_1.jpg);height:92px; width:986px;margin:0px auto;}

/*--------导航样式-----------*/
.nav{ background:url(../images/bg_nav_1.gif); height:30px; width:986px;margin:0px auto;text-align:center}
.nav ol li {margin: 8px}
#tags {padding:0;margin: 0px 0px 0px 20px;width:800px;height: 30px}
#tags li{float:left;list-style-type:none;width:30px;background:url(../images/bg_nav_3.gif) no-repeat right;}
#tags li a{text-align:center;height:30px;width:69px;line-height:30px;text-decoration: none;font-size:13px;color:#C71110}
#tags li a:hover{color:#FFF}
#tags li.selecttag {background:url(../images/bg_nav_2.gif);width:15px;font-weight:bold}
#tags li.selecttag a {color: #FFF; line-height: 30px; height: 30px;font-size:14px;}
#tagcontent {line-height:30px;color:#FFF;}
.tagcontent {display: none;}
#tagcontent div.selecttag {display: block}

/*--------切换样式1-----------*/
.mid_d5{ width:272px;height:175px;margin-top:6px;}
.mid_d5ex{
	width:80px;
	height:170px;
	margin-top:1px;
	border: 0px dashed #FF9933;
}
.mid_d5dc{
	width:290px;
	height:110px;
	margin-top:2px;
	border: 1px solid #FF9933;
}
#ta {padding:0;margin: 0;width:291px;height: 28px; background:url(../images/bg_mid_10.gif);text-align:center;}
#ta li{float:left;margin-right:2px;list-style-type:none;width:73px;background:url(../images/bg_mid_11.gif) no-repeat right;}
#ta li a{width:73px;line-height:28px;text-decoration: none;font-size:12px;color:#686868}
#ta li a:hover{color:#FF0000}
#ta li.sele {background:url(../images/bg_mid_12.gif);width:73px;font-weight:bold}
#ta li.sele a {color: #8A5A36; line-height: 28px; height: 28px;font-size:12px;}
#tag {line-height:30px;color:#333;border:1px solid #D4D4D4;border-top:0;width:291px;height:145px;}
.tag {display: none;}
#tag div.sele {display: block}
.viedage_1{padding:0px;border-bottom:1px dotted #C6C6C6;}
.viedage_1 img{margin:0 3px;}
.tag li{display:block;width:120px;float:left; background:url(../images/img_8.gif) no-repeat 5px; text-indent:20px;margin-left:15px;margin-top:5px;color:#FF6600}

/*--------切换样式2-----------*/
#taa {padding:0;margin: 0;width:291px;height: 28px; background:url(../images/bg_mid_10.gif);text-align:center;}
#taa li{float:left;margin-right:2px;list-style-type:none;width:73px;background:url(../images/bg_mid_11.gif) no-repeat right;}
#taa li a{width:73px;line-height:28px;text-decoration: none;font-size:12px;color:#686868}
#taa li a:hover{color:#FF0000}
#taa li.selea {background:url(../images/bg_mid_12.gif);width:73px;font-weight:bold}
#taa li.selea a {color: #8A5A36; line-height: 28px; height: 28px;font-size:12px;}
#taga {line-height:30px;color:#333;border:1px solid #D4D4D4;border-top:0;width:291px;height:145px;}
.taga {display: none;}
#taga div.selea {display: block}
.viedage_2{padding:3px;border-bottom:1px dotted #C6C6C6;}
.viedage_2 img{margin:0 3px;}
.viedage_2 span{display:block;float:right;text-indent:24px;width:175px;line-height:160%;}
.taga li{margin-top:2px; text-indent:7px}
/*--------内容样式-----------*/
.mid{background:#FFF; height:500px; width:986px;margin:0px auto;text-align:left;padding:5px;}

.mid_d1{width:672px;height:220px;border-right:1px solid #FFC796;float:left}
.mid_d1 .d1_top{ height:27px;background:url(../images/bg_mid_2.gif);line-height:25px;}
.xwtittop{float:left;background:url(../images/bg_mid_1.gif);width:87px;height:27px;font-size:14px;font-weight:bold;margin:0 15px;color:#C51605;text-align:center;}
.center_d2{padding:18px 0;width:410px;float:left;margin-left:10px;}
.center_d2 li{margin:4px 0;}
.mid_d1 .d1_1{
	/*border:1px solid #FD9500;*/
	width:247px;
	height:220px;
	float:left;
	padding:0px;
	border-top-width: 0px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: #FD9500;
	border-right-color: #FD9500;
	border-bottom-color: #FD9500;
	border-left-color: #FD9500;
}
.mid_d1 .d1_2{
	float:left;
	width:400px;
	height:220px;
	margin-left:10px;
	border-top-width: 0px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: #FF9900;
	border-right-color: #FF9900;
	border-bottom-color: #FF9900;
	border-left-color: #FF9900;
}


.mid_d2{
	float:right;
	margin-left:6px;
	border: 0px solid #FF9933;
	height: 100px;
}
.mid_d2 .d2_top{background:url(../images/bg_mid_3.gif);width:290px;height:23px;line-height:160%;font-size:14px;font-weight:bold;color:#FFF;padding-left:24px;}
.mid_d2 .d2_center{width:290px;height:50px;background:url(../images/bg_mid_4.gif);padding:5px 15px;}
.mid_d2 .d2_top2{ background:url(../images/bg_mid_6.gif); width:272px; height:30px;line-height:200%; padding-left:30px;font-size:14px;font-weight:bold;color:#FFF;}
/*.mid_d2 .d2_center2{ background:url(../images/bg_mid_5.gif) bottom; width:272px;height:200px;border:1px solid #F8AE45;border-top:0;padding:15px;}*/
.mid_d2 .d2_center3{
	width:290px;
	height:50px;
	padding:2px;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: #F8AE45;
	border-right-color: #F8AE45;
	border-bottom-color: #F8AE45;
	border-left-color: #F8AE45;
	font-size: 1px;
}
.mid_d2 .d2_center2{
	width:290px;
	height:240px;
	padding:2px;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: #F8AE45;
	border-right-color: #F8AE45;
	border-bottom-color: #F8AE45;
	border-left-color: #F8AE45;
	font-size: 1px;
}
.mid_d2 .d2_center2 li{ text-indent:24px; border-bottom:1px dotted #C6C6C6;margin-bottom:10px;}
.mid_d2 .d3_top{background: url(../images/bg_mid_13.gif);width:272px;height:33px;margin-top:5px;text-indent:20px;font-weight:bold;color:#FFF;line-height:30px}
.mid_d2 .d3_center{
	height:240px;
	width:290px;
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: #B5B7B4;
	border-right-color: #B5B7B4;
	border-bottom-color: #B5B7B4;
	border-left-color: #B5B7B4;
}
.d3_center li{margin:4px 0;}
.mid_d3{
	width:672px;
	height:185px;
	float:left;
	margin-bottom:2px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-right-color: #FFC796;
	border-bottom-color: #FFC796;
}
.mid_center{
	width:674px;
	height:70px;
	float:left;
	margin-bottom:4px;
	border-right-width: 0px;
	border-bottom-width: 0px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-right-color: #FFC796;
	border-bottom-color: #FFC796;
	margin-top: 0px;
}
.mid_d3 .d3_1{border:1px solid #FD9500;width:245px;height:179px;float:left;padding:0px;}
.mid_d3 .d3_1top{background:url(../images/bg_mid_7.gif);width:240px;height:23px;padding-left:30px;line-height:200%;font-weight:bold;color:#FFF;}
.mid_d3 .li1{background:url(../images/img_3.gif) no-repeat 10px;background-color:#FDFDFD;border-bottom:1px dotted #D8DCDB;height:20px; text-indent:34px;padding-top:4px;}
.mid_d3 .li2{background:url(../images/img_3.gif) no-repeat 10px;background-color:#F1F9FC;border-bottom:1px dotted #D8DCDB;height:20px;text-indent:34px;padding-top:4px;}

.mid_d3 .d3_2{
	float:left;
	width:400px;
	height:180px;
	margin-left:10px;
	border-top-width: 0px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: #FF9900;
	border-right-color: #FF9900;
	border-bottom-color: #FF9900;
	border-left-color: #FF9900;
}
.mid_d3 .d3_2top{background:url(../images/bg_mid_8.gif);width:410px;height:23px;padding-left:15px;line-height:200%;font-weight:bold;color:#FFF;}

.center_d3{padding:4px 0;width:390px;float:left;margin-left:5px;}
.center_d3 li{margin:4px 0;}
.mid_d4{height:310px;}
.mid_d4 .d3_1{height:300px;}
.mid_d4 .d3_2{height:152px;}
.mid_d4 .d3_3top{background:url(../images/bg_mid_9.gif);width:410px;height:23px;padding-left:15px;line-height:200%;font-weight:bold;color:#000;}
/*.d5_1{background:url(../images/bg_mid_14.gif);width:673px;height:28px;float:left;font-size:14px;font-weight:bold;text-indent:24px;color:red;line-height:200%;}*/
.d5_1{background:url(../images/bg_mid_14.gif);width:290px;height:28px;font-size:14px;font-weight:bold;text-indent:24px;color:red;line-height:200%;}
.d5_2{
	width:290px;
	height:140px;
	margin:0;
	background-color: #FF6633;
}
.botnav{background:#E44E01;height:30px;width:986px;margin:0px auto;text-align:center;color:#FFF;line-height:30px;}
.foot{
	height:80px;
	width:986px;
	margin:0px auto;
	text-align:center;
	color:gray;
	line-height:30px;
	background-color: #EFEFEF;
}
.botban{background:#FFF;height:60px;width:986px;margin:0px auto;text-align:center;color:#FFF;line-height:30px;}
.picexprol{float:left;width:243px;height:228px; border:1px solid #999999;padding:3px;}
.d2_top22 {
	font-size: 9px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	background-color: #CC9933;
	width: 272px;
	height: 230px;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 0px;
}

/*-----------------CLASS_1-----------------
.mid2{background:#FFF; height:720px; width:976px;margin:0px auto;padding:5px;text-align:left}
.midcl_d1{width:700px;height:700px;border-right:1px solid #FFC796;float:left}
.midcl_d1 .d1_top{ height:27px;background:url(../images/bg_mid_2.gif);line-height:25px;}
.solighet{line-height:30px;height:30px; background:url(../images/img_8.gif) no-repeat 10px; text-indent:24px;;}
.midcl_d1 li{background:url(../images/img_3.gif) no-repeat 10px;border-bottom:1px dotted #D8DCDB;height:35px; text-indent:34px;line-height:35px;font-size:14px;}
.midcl_d1 ul{padding:20px;}

.midcleft{width:260px;float:left;height:700px;margin-right:10px;}
.midcleft .img1{ background:url(../images/bancla_1.jpg); width:257px; height:58px;}
.midcleft_m1{ height:300px; width:250px; border:1px solid #FFAC8E;margin-top:10px;padding:3px;}
.midcleft_m1 a{color:#C43400}
.midcleft_m1 .top{ background:url(../images/bg_cl_1.gif); width:249px; height:28px; color:#FFF;line-height:200%; font-weight:bold; text-indent:10px;}
.midcleft_m1 .li1{background:url(../images/img_10.gif) no-repeat 10px;background-color:#FFF;border-bottom:1px dotted #D8DCDB;height:27px; text-indent:60px;padding-top:5px;font-size:14px;font-weight:bold;}
.midcleft_m1 .li2{background:url(../images/img_10.gif) no-repeat 10px;background-color:#FFF4F0;border-bottom:1px dotted #D8DCDB;height:27px;text-indent:60px;padding-top:5px;font-size:14px;font-weight:bold;}*/
